|
| QgsRasterDataProviderTemporalCapabilities (bool enabled=false) |
| Constructor for QgsRasterDataProviderTemporalProperties. More...
|
|
QList< QgsDateTimeRange > | allAvailableTemporalRanges () const |
| Returns a list of all valid datetime ranges for which temporal data is available from the provider. More...
|
|
const QgsDateTimeRange & | availableReferenceTemporalRange () const |
| Returns the available reference datetime range, which indicates the maximum extent of datetime values available for reference temporal ranges from the provider. More...
|
|
const QgsDateTimeRange & | availableTemporalRange () const |
| Returns the overall datetime range extent from which temporal data is available from the provider. More...
|
|
QgsInterval | defaultInterval () const |
| Returns the default time step interval corresponding to the available datetime values for the provider. More...
|
|
Qgis::RasterTemporalCapabilityFlags | flags () const |
| Returns the capability flags for the provider. More...
|
|
Qgis::TemporalIntervalMatchMethod | intervalHandlingMethod () const |
| Returns the desired method to use when resolving a temporal interval to matching layers or bands in the data provider. More...
|
|
const QgsDateTimeRange & | requestedTemporalRange () const |
| Returns the requested temporal range. More...
|
|
void | setAllAvailableTemporalRanges (const QList< QgsDateTimeRange > &ranges) |
| Sets a list of all valid datetime ranges for which temporal data is available from the provider. More...
|
|
void | setAvailableReferenceTemporalRange (const QgsDateTimeRange &range) |
| Sets the available reference datetime range. More...
|
|
void | setAvailableTemporalRange (const QgsDateTimeRange &range) |
| Sets the overall datetime range extent from which temporal data is available from the provider. More...
|
|
void | setDefaultInterval (const QgsInterval &interval) |
| Sets the default time step interval corresponding to the available datetime values for the provider. More...
|
|
void | setFlags (Qgis::RasterTemporalCapabilityFlags flags) |
| Sets the capability flags for the provider. More...
|
|
void | setIntervalHandlingMethod (Qgis::TemporalIntervalMatchMethod method) |
| Sets the desired method to use when resolving a temporal interval to matching layers or bands in the data provider. More...
|
|
void | setRequestedTemporalRange (const QgsDateTimeRange &range) |
| Sets the requested temporal range to retrieve when returning data from the associated data provider. More...
|
|
| QgsDataProviderTemporalCapabilities (bool available=false) |
| Constructor for QgsDataProviderTemporalCapabilities. More...
|
|
virtual | ~QgsDataProviderTemporalCapabilities ()=default |
|
bool | hasTemporalCapabilities () const |
| Returns true if the provider has temporal capabilities available. More...
|
|
void | setHasTemporalCapabilities (bool available) |
| Sets whether the provider has temporal capabilities available. More...
|
|